What Is Pure Water?

‘Pure Water’ is water that has been treated to remove any dissolved solids particles from the water. Tap water is full of these contaminants. Which stop you from being able to wash with water alone without leaving marks, spots, and smears, etc. Believe it or not. Water from the tap these days is not “Pure Water” and is full of impurities. The level of these impurities varies from each area around the country. Here in Leicestershire and Northamptonshire our tap water is fairly good. That is compared to other parts of the Country. However, you would not be able to clean your windows with this water. It would leave nasty spots and stains all over your glass.
